Output 6598f2de8577d1f10177f0d68b9a6ec1ef26e98db91add6ac6e237c46a2702c9:4

value
5944364
script pubkey
OP_0 OP_PUSHBYTES_32 32b0f3671bbbed3cb2eeb8cf388e8f67002a68726e85e4771882066d24877644
address
bc1qx2c0xecmh0knevhwhr8n3r50vuqz56rjd6z7gaccsgrx6fy8wezqe5qpt8
transaction
6598f2de8577d1f10177f0d68b9a6ec1ef26e98db91add6ac6e237c46a2702c9
spent
true